  • UMBC Cyberdawgs place 2nd at MDC3

    The UMBC Cyberdawgs triumphed at the Maryland Cyber Challenge & Conference (MDC3) yesterday. The team placed second at the MDC3 finals, held Wednesday at the Baltimore Convention Center.   • Northrop Grumman Foundation and UMBC announce UMBC Cyber Scholars Program

    UMBC is partnering with the Northrop Grumman Foundation to launch the UMBC Cyber Scholars Program.   • CS alumna Stephanie Hill ('86) to be honored at UMBC's Outstanding Alumni of the Year Awards

    Computer Science alumna (’86) Stephanie C. Hill will be honored at this year’s Outstanding Alumni of the Year Awards on October 11, 7:30 p.m. in the Albin O. Kuhn Library.
